C-Suite Wednesday — Nominate Someone for Coleman’s 2017 SBA Lending Awards

Nominations are open for outstanding and innovative SBA lending professionals in the following three categories.

2017 Top-25 SBA Lending Professionals
2017 Top-10 Women of SBA Lending
2017 Top-10 Young Professionals of SBA Lending

Awards are open to all SBA lending professionals. Winners could come from a broad spectrum of organizations — lenders, CDCs, secondary markets, organizations such as SCORE and SBDCs, small business advocacy and trade groups, support vendors, thought leaders and academia, and government, SBA employees.

The nominations and/or testimonials should address why the nominee should be honored and how the nominee has made a positive impact in their community and the SBA lending industry.

There is no entry fee.

Here are some of the ground rules for the inaugural year of the awards.

  • Top-10 Young Professionals category is eligible for anyone aged 39 or less as of December 31, 1977.
  • You may be nominated for more than one category.
  • Judges will be appointed by Coleman Publishing. (2017 winners will be invited to judge the 2018 awards).
  • Deadline to apply is July 31, 2017.
  • Finalists will be announced September 30, 2017.
  • Winners will be announced at an event in Washington DC in the first week of December 2017. (Attendance is encouraged, but not required.)
  • Testimonials will be accepted to support nominations.
